On 1/6/2012 2:35 AM, Alexandre Chapellon wrote: In case of hardware (tape or disk) failure... Don't really know how to recover from such situation.
For tapes, bacula should instruct you when a tape should be changed... I don't know how bacula decides a tape has to be changed however.


The only protection from hardware failure is redundancy. Backups should be scheduled so that at any given time there is always more than one backup on different media. Bacula's Copy jobs can be useful for this.
